Driveway grading and graveling services involve preparing and leveling the surface of a driveway to ensure proper drainage and a stable base. This process typically includes removing existing debris, shaping the ground to the correct slope, and adding or redistributing gravel or other aggregate materials. Proper grading helps prevent water pooling and reduces the risk of erosion, which can cause uneven surfaces or damage over time. Graveling enhances the driveway’s durability and appearance, creating a solid, well-drained surface that can withstand regular use and weather conditions.
These services are often sought after to address common driveway problems such as uneven surfaces, potholes, or areas prone to flooding. Over time, driveways can shift or sink, leading to a bumpy ride and potential damage to vehicles. Poor drainage can also result in standing water, which accelerates deterioration and makes the driveway unsafe or unusable. Driveway grading and graveling help resolve these issues by restoring a level surface, improving drainage, and providing a resilient base that extends the lifespan of the driveway.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Grading And Grave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Oxon Hill,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way grading or graveling projects in Oxon Hill, MD often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and condition of the driveway.
Standard Graveling - For standard graveling services, local contractors usually charge between $600-$1,200. Larger, more extensive graveling projects can reach $1,500 or more, especially if additional site prep is needed.
Full Driveway Grading - Complete driveway grading services generally cost between $1,200-$3,500. Most projects in this category fall within this range, with more complex or larger driveways pushing costs higher.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ire driveway with grading and graveling can range from $3,500-$8,000 or more. Larger, more intricate projects or those requiring extensive preparation tend to be at the higher end of this sp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
